Public bug reported:

For example, from a fresh jammy container:

root@j:~# do-release-upgrade                         
Checking for a new Ubuntu release
Could not find the release announcement
The server may be overloaded.

Or from a fresh noble container:

root@n:~# do-release-upgrade -d
Checking for a new Ubuntu release
Could not find the release announcement
The server may be overloaded.

This error message corresponds to u-r-u getting a 403 when attempting to
reach the release announcement page. Note that at the time of writing,
the pages are accessible by browser, curl, etc. but not u-r-u.

In fact, requests.get seems to work, but urllib.request.urlopen (which
u-r-u uses) gets a 403:
